Bhopal: Congress national president Rahul Gandhi during his Bhopal visit on Friday reviewed the farm loan waiver scheme. In a meeting with Chief Minister Kamal Nath and other party leaders at state hanger, Rahul inquiring about the process of filing of applications, sought to know the time when the amount would be transferred in farmers’ bank accounts.
He asked Nath to ensure that the money in farmers’ account reach before model code of conduct for Lok Sabha polls comes into effect. Loan waiver amount should be credited into the bank accounts of maximum number of farmers before announcement of Lok Sabha polls, said Rahul.
Nath, the state party president, also apprised Rahul about farm loan waiver process and the works done after Congress coming to power in the state. Rahul appreciated state government Gaushala scheme. Nath also informed about the 100 units electricity for Rs 100 and Yuva Swabhimaan Yojana made for the unemployed.
He told party chief that the state government has fulfilled 26 points of Vachan Patra and work on the points which are not expensive to implement is also on. Rahul also had lunch with main Congress leaders at state hanger after which he left for public meeting at Jumboree Maidan.
